Many users find themselves with the Omen Gaming Hub installed on their computers without their knowledge. This often occurs when the software installs itself alongside other applications. If you’re looking to remove the Omen Gaming Hub, you’re not alone, and this guide will help you through the process.
The first step in removing the Omen Gaming Hub is to check your Control Panel. Navigate to the 'Add or Remove Programs' section to see if the Omen Gaming Hub is listed. If you don’t find it under HP or Omen, don’t worry; there are other methods to locate and uninstall it.
If the Omen Gaming Hub is not found in the Control Panel, the next step is to look in your Program Files. Open the 'Program Files' directory on your computer and check both the x64 and x86 folders for any HP or Omen-related files. If you don’t find anything, a more thorough search may be necessary.
To locate any traces of the Omen Gaming Hub, perform a search across your entire computer. Use the search function to look for 'Omen' and review the results. This will help you identify any files or folders associated with the program that may need to be deleted.
Before attempting to delete any files, it’s crucial to check the Task Manager for any running processes related to the Omen Gaming Hub. Look for any instances of the program and end those processes. This step is essential to avoid errors when trying to delete files.
Once you have ended any running processes, return to the search results from your previous scan. Carefully check the file paths and navigate to each location to delete the identified files. If you encounter any errors, it may be because the files have already been deleted.
After deleting all identified files, it’s a good idea to run another search for 'Omen' to ensure that no traces remain. Additionally, check the Task Manager one last time to confirm that no Omen processes are running. Restart your computer to finalize the uninstallation and verify that the Omen Gaming Hub icon is no longer present.
